To assess the knowledge and practice regarding foot care among diabetes patients at Krishna Hospital, Karad

Gholap Manisha C.1, Mohite Vaishali R.

Krishna Institute of Medical Sciences Deemed University, Krishna Institute of Nursing Sciences, Karad, Maharashtra, India

1Corresponding author

Online published on 31 January, 2014.

Abstract

This paper study for assess the knowledge and practices regarding foot care among diabetes patients. Determine the association between knowledge and practices regarding foot care among diabetes patients with selected demographic variables and find the co-relation between knowledge and practice regarding foot care among diabetes patients. The level of knowledge score of diabetic patients regarding foot care reveals that majority 29(58%) had average knowledge, 12(24%) had good knowledge and 9(18%) had poor knowledge. The level of practice score of diabetic patients regarding foot care reveals that majority 29(58%) had average practice, 11(22%) had good practice and 10(20%) had poor practice. There was a perfect correlation between knowledge and practice regarding foot care among diabetic patients which means there is increase in knowledge with increase in practice of the patients.
